Westchester Fall 2008

Valhalla, New York · 22 November 2008 · 9 events · 60 competitors · 54 personal bests

Dan Cohen won five of the nine events (3×3, 3×3 blindfolded, 3×3 one-handed) and the closest final was the Master Magic, won by Sam Boyles by 0.17 seconds. 60 competitors produced 54 personal bests, 11 of which still stand today, and 17 people held a competitor card for the first time.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a final is a competition's last round; its order decides the podium ·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· every solve starts from a computer-generated scramble, the same for every competitor in a round.
